Number of under-five deaths in Kazakhstan
Kazakhstan: Number of under-five deaths was 3,876 in 2024. ◆ Volatile
Number of under-five deaths in Kazakhstan, 1976–2024
Source: World Health Organization, Global Health Observatory.
Analysis
Kazakhstan recorded 3,876 for number of under-five deaths in 2024. That is the lowest value across all 49 years on record.
Compared with earlier readings it is down 3.5% on the previous year and down 25.5% over ten years.
Over the whole period, number of under-five deaths in Kazakhstan peaked at 27,232 in 1980 and was at its lowest, 3,876, in 2024.
Kazakhstan ranks 75th of 199 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
